• What is the role of shadows in 3D rendering?

    Shadows play a crucial role in 3D rendering as they contribute to the overall realism, depth, and visual coherence of the rendered scene. Here are the key roles of shadows in 3D rendering:

    1. Depth Perception: Shadows provide visual cues for depth perception in a 3D render. By casting shadows, objects appear to have volume and occupy space in the scene. The presence of shadows helps to define the relationships between objects and their positions in relation to light sources and other surfaces. This depth perception enhances the realism and spatial understanding of the rendered scene.

    2. Realism and Believability: Shadows contribute to the realism and believability of a 3D render by simulating the way light interacts with objects and the environment. In the real world, objects cast shadows when light is blocked by them. By accurately depicting shadows, the rendered scene mimics the natural behavior of light, making the virtual objects appear more lifelike and convincing.

    3. Light and Shadow Contrast: Shadows create a contrast between areas that are illuminated and those that are not. This interplay of light and shadow adds visual interest, drama, and dynamic range to the rendered scene. By manipulating the intensity and softness of shadows, artists can control the mood, focus, and overall aesthetics of the composition.

    4. Object Placement and Integration: Shadows help to anchor objects in their environment and facilitate their integration into the scene. By casting shadows onto other surfaces or objects, virtual objects appear to interact with their surroundings. This integration enhances the sense of realism and coherence, making the objects feel more connected to their environment.

    5. Shape and Form Definition: Shadows define the shape, form, and contour of objects. They provide visual information about the surface topology and geometry of objects by highlighting their curves, edges, and surface details. Shadows contribute to the perception of object dimensions and aid in distinguishing different parts and features of objects, enhancing their visual appeal and realism.

    6. Spatial Relationships: Shadows provide important spatial cues by indicating the relative positions and orientations of objects in the scene. They help viewers understand the spatial arrangement and distance between objects, aiding in the comprehension of the scene’s layout. Shadows also contribute to the sense of scale, allowing viewers to gauge the sizes of objects based on their shadow sizes and positions.

    7. Visual Focus and Composition: Shadows can be used artistically to guide the viewer’s attention and create a focal point in the scene. By manipulating the placement and intensity of shadows, artists can draw attention to specific objects, elements, or areas of interest. Shadows also play a role in composition, balancing the distribution of light and dark areas to create visually pleasing and balanced renderings.

    In summary, shadows in 3D rendering serve important roles such as providing depth perception, enhancing realism, creating contrast, facilitating object integration, defining shape and form, establishing spatial relationships, and guiding visual focus. By incorporating accurate and visually appealing shadows, 3D renders achieve a higher level of realism, depth, and aesthetic quality.
